What Happened: Intel (INTC) stock surged over 10% today, climbing above $135 to a new record high FXLeaders, Moby. This significant rally followed an announcement from President Trump that "Apple has agreed to work with Intel to design and build its chips in America" FXLeaders. The news reversed earlier weekly volatility for Intel. In parallel, Intel also showcased improvements to its Intel 18A and 18A-P manufacturing technologies and confirmed the 18A-P process has entered risk production FXLeaders.
Why It Matters: This partnership is a "historic chip manufacturing partnership" and a major endorsement for Intel's foundry business, which is central to its long-term recovery strategy FXLeaders. Securing Apple (AAPL) as a high-profile client boosts confidence in Intel's ability to become a leading contract chip manufacturer, potentially attracting more customers and validating its technology roadmap. For Apple, the agreement offers a strategic opportunity to diversify its manufacturing base beyond TSMC, reducing supply chain concentration and mitigating geopolitical risks by localizing chip production in the U.S. [FXLeaders](REFaf732dfb].

What Happened: On June 18, 2026, the Brotherhood of Locomotive Engineers and Trainmen (BLET) and the Teamsters Rail Conference applauded an action by the House Appropriations Committee. The Committee urged the Surface Transportation Board (STB) to conduct a "rigorous review" of the proposed Union Pacific-Norfolk Southern (UP-NS) merger Google. This directive was included in the FY2027 Transportation, Housing and Urban Development (THUD) Appropriations bill, specifically on page 112 of the Committee’s bipartisan markup report [Google](REF2dbb1e32]. The report instructs the STB to ensure the transaction provides "substantial public benefits, enhanced competition for rail shippers, and protections for the U.S. economy and consumers" Google.
Why It Matters: The congressional oversight and explicit call for a rigorous review, coupled with the reaffirmation of stringent 2001 merger rules, signify a substantial increase in regulatory scrutiny for the proposed UP-NS merger [Google](REF2dbb1e32]. This heightened review, focusing on public benefits and competition, suggests a challenging path to approval, potentially delaying or even preventing the transaction [Google](REF2dbb1e32], Google. Concerns raised by the Stop the Rail Merger Coalition—regarding anti-competitive harms, potential price increases, workforce impact, and supply chain stability—highlight significant hurdles for the merging parties to overcome to demonstrate public interest benefits [Google](REF2dbb1e32].
